Located between Oxford and Henley, this hotel boasts beautiful views of a quiet part of the Thames River. Guests can enjoy the outdoor heated swimming pool, free parking, and a restaurant and bar. Rooms at The Shillingford Bridge Hotel features a private bathroom with a hairdryer. Guests can relax with a TV, radio, and free tea and coffee. Some rooms are in the main building, while others are in the hotel's grounds. Some rooms also include river views. The River View Restaurant serves freshly prepared food and has panoramic views of the hotel's grounds and lawns to the Thames. The River Bar serves light meals and snacks and has an outdoor terrace with river views. Wallingford’s center is just a 5-minute drive away, while Oxford can be reached in 20 minutes by car. Windsor Castle is a 5 minute drive away, and Dorchester is less than 10 minutes from the hotel by car. Hotel Rooms: 40, Hotel Chain: Akkeron Hotels.
